Surge in Tantalum Prices Signals China's Push for Supply Chain Control

by CHO YONG SUNG Posted : September 4, 2026, 11:00Updated : September 4, 2026, 11:00

The price of tantalum (element symbol Ta, atomic number 73), a rare metal essential for building AI servers and data centers, has soared to record levels in the first half of this year. China is gearing up to dominate the tantalum supply chain.


According to the Shanghai Securities Journal, citing statistics from the China Nonferrous Metals Industry Association, prices for key metals in the AI industry, including tin, tantalum, and indium, have surged in the first half of this year. Tin prices rose by 40%, tantalum by 158%, and indium by 60%. Among these, tantalum saw the highest increase. The spot price of tantalum ore jumped from about 2,600 yuan per kilogram at the end of last year to approximately 6,900 yuan by the end of June. In March, it peaked at 7,300 yuan per kilogram (about $1,410).


Tantalum is primarily used in three sectors: tantalum capacitors, semiconductor target materials, and high-temperature alloys. While a typical server contains 30 to 50 tantalum capacitors, NVIDIA's AI server, the 'GB200,' uses between 3,000 and 5,000, marking a nearly 100-fold increase in usage. Despite the surge in demand, supply remains limited. Tantalum is found in very small quantities, with the Democratic Republic of the Congo, Rwanda, and Nigeria accounting for over 80% of global production. In March, a mine in Congo halted operations due to heavy rains and landslides, exacerbating supply shortages.


China is securing long-term supply contracts with tantalum mines and is working to acquire technology for high-purity refining. Dongfang Tantalum, a leading player in China's tantalum industry, signed a long-term purchase agreement for 3,600 tons of tantalum-niobium alloy with Brazil's Taboca Mining this year. Additionally, Dongfang Tantalum recently raised 1.2 billion yuan through a capital increase, which will be invested in wet and dry refining and high-end product production lines.


A representative from the Chinese industry stated, 'China is a global leader in tantalum processing, but the self-sufficiency rate for raw materials is low, and the technology for ultra-high-cost tantalum powder and semiconductor-grade high-purity tantalum refining has not yet reached global top levels.'
